What to Do Immediately After Getting Busted in San Marcos, TX

Alright, guys, let's get practical. You've been busted in San Marcos, TX, and your mind is probably racing. What's the very next step? First and foremost, remain calm and polite. Even if you feel you're innocent or the situation is unfair, escalating the interaction with law enforcement will not help your case. Remember the Miranda rights: you have the right to remain silent. Do NOT waive this right. Anything you say can and will be used against you. It’s best to avoid discussing the details of the alleged incident with anyone other than your attorney. If you are arrested, cooperate with the booking process, but keep your statements to a minimum. If you are issued a citation, carefully review it to ensure all the information is accurate, especially your name, the alleged offense, and the court date. Take a clear photo of the citation for your records. If you are released on bond, make sure you understand the conditions of your release and that you attend all required court dates. Missing a court date can lead to a warrant for your arrest, making your situation significantly worse. Your priority should be securing legal representation as soon as possible. The sooner you connect with a lawyer, the sooner they can start building your defense and advising you on the best course of action. Don't delay in seeking professional help; time is often of the essence in legal matters. Potential Outcomes and Next Steps After Being Busted in San Marcos, TX

So, you've been busted in San Marcos, TX, and you've got legal representation. What happens now? The potential outcomes of a criminal case can vary widely, depending on the specifics of the charges, the evidence, and the effectiveness of your defense. Your attorney will be your best guide in understanding these possibilities. Common outcomes can include dismissal of charges, a plea bargain, or a trial. Dismissal means the charges are dropped, often due to insufficient evidence or procedural errors. A plea bargain involves an agreement where you plead guilty or no contest to a lesser charge or receive a lighter sentence in exchange for avoiding a trial. This can be a strategic option to minimize penalties. If a plea agreement isn't reached or isn't in your best interest, your case might proceed to trial, where a judge or jury will decide your guilt or innocence. Even if convicted, there are still subsequent steps, such as sentencing, where your attorney will advocate for the most lenient outcome possible, potentially including probation, community service, or rehabilitation programs instead of jail time. Understanding the legal process and potential consequences is key to preparing yourself mentally and making informed decisions. Your attorney will explain the next steps, which might include attending court hearings, meeting with probation officers, or completing mandated programs. Stay in close communication with your lawyer and follow their advice diligently.
